S.D. Bar President Youngest in Its History
Passionate about his job as a deputy district attorney in the family protection unit, new San Diego County Bar Association President Dan Link is equally enthusiastic about his goals for the 10,000-member association in the coming year.




Daily Journal Staff Writer
SAN DIEGO - The year was 1999. Dan Link was a young law student interning with the San Diego County district attorney's office, and he had just been handed a rare opportunity: Tackling his first felony case.
His supervisor, Brenda Daly, assured him the defendant, who walked away from a work-furlough facility, would plead guilty. But the defendant had a change of heart. He wanted a trial.
